A “deodorant detox” is not a bodily cleanse. Your liver and kidneys handle systemic toxin removal, not your armpits. What the term does describe, usefully, is the microbiome adjustment period after you stop aluminium-based antiperspirants and switch to a natural deodorant. That transition is real, it can be smelly, and there are safe, evidence-backed ways to ease it.

What does a “deodorant detox” actually claim to do?
The term gets used loosely to describe everything from a single clay mask session to a weeks-long product-free reset. Typical methods include bentonite or kaolin clay masks, charcoal masks, diluted apple cider vinegar rinses, baking soda scrubs, and simply stopping all underarm products cold.
The claimed outcomes range from “drawing out toxins” to “resetting your sweat glands.” No solid medical or scientific evidence supports those systemic claims. Sweat is not a meaningful detox pathway. Any real benefit is local: removing product residue, shifting local skin pH, or temporarily changing the bacterial population on your skin.
Why do some people feel better after a “detox” period? Usually because they stopped using a product that was irritating them, because thorough washing removed waxy antiperspirant residue, or because their microbiome simply rebalanced with time. Soap and water alone will remove most antiperspirant buildup, and aggressive recipes are generally unnecessary.
Research on this topic is still limited in scale. Systematic reviews note a lack of large clinical trials, so cautious wording is warranted when describing what any specific method does.
Why you often smell more right after switching to natural deodorant
Aluminium salts in antiperspirants work by temporarily blocking sweat ducts. Less sweat means less moisture for bacteria to feed on, which means less odour. Over months or years of use, your underarm microbiome adapts to that low-moisture environment, favouring bacterial communities that thrive under those conditions.
When you stop antiperspirant, sweat flow returns quickly. The microbial community that was shaped by low moisture suddenly gets a flood of substrate to work with. Peer-reviewed studies document measurable shifts in underarm microbiota after antiperspirant use versus non-use, and the transitional bloom of odour-producing bacteria, particularly Corynebacterium species, is what causes that sharp, unfamiliar smell many people notice in the first one to two weeks.
The good news: clay or charcoal masks can bind residue and lower local pH, discouraging odour-causing bacteria, while the microbiome gradually rebalances toward milder communities. Think of it as a microbial adjustment, not a toxic purge. Targeting the local environment — pH, residue, moisture — is what actually speeds recovery. What are the realistic stages when you stop antiperspirant?
Most people adjust within a few weeks, with some heavy long-term users taking longer to transition. Here is what each stage typically looks like:
- Days 0–3 (wash-out): Sweat returns to normal flow. You may notice more wetness than usual but odour is often mild because the bacterial community hasn’t shifted yet.
- Days 4–14 (microbial rebound): The most challenging phase. Odour-producing bacteria bloom as they adapt to the new moisture environment. This is the stage most people misread as a sign that natural deodorant “doesn’t work.”
- Weeks 2–4 (stabilisation): Odour-producing species begin to lose their competitive advantage. Milder bacterial communities re-establish. Most people notice a clear improvement.
- Weeks 4–6+ (longer tail): Heavy, long-term antiperspirant users may need the full six weeks. Hormonal fluctuations, a high-protein diet, or a recent illness can extend this phase.
Factors that affect your timeline:
- 🌡️ Heat and humidity (Canadian summers, saunas, hot yoga) increase moisture and can prolong the rebound phase — plan for an extra application on hot days
- 🏃 High exercise frequency accelerates sweat output and may intensify days 4–14
- 🥩 Diet high in red meat, sulphur-rich foods, or alcohol can worsen transitional odour
- 💊 Hormonal changes (menstrual cycle, thyroid shifts) affect sweat composition
For work and social situations during days 4–14: wear natural, breathable fabrics (linen, cotton), carry a small travel-size natural deodorant for midday reapplication, and shower or rinse underarms at midday if possible.
What actually helps: safe methods to ease the switch
The most effective approach is layered: a solid daily hygiene baseline, one weekly mask, and targeted use of gentle acids or diluted apple cider vinegar when needed. Here is how to do each safely.
Daily hygiene baseline
- Wash underarms with a gentle, fragrance-free cleanser morning and evening.
- Pat completely dry — bacteria multiply faster on damp skin.
- Apply natural deodorant to clean, dry skin only. Applying over sweat or residue reduces efficacy significantly.
Weekly clay or charcoal mask protocol
- Mix one tablespoon of bentonite or kaolin clay (such as Aztec Secret Indian Healing Clay) with enough water or diluted apple cider vinegar (one part ACV to two parts water) to form a smooth paste.
- Apply a thin, even layer to clean, dry underarms.
- Leave on for 10–15 minutes. Remove before it dries completely and tightens.
- Rinse thoroughly with warm water and pat dry.
- Limit to once per week. More frequent use strips the skin barrier. The Megababe Happy Pits Underarm Mask is a pre-formulated option that follows similar principles with added soothing botanicals, useful if you prefer a ready-mixed product.
Pro Tip: If you have sensitive skin, use plain water instead of ACV in your clay mix for the first two sessions. Introduce diluted ACV only once you’ve confirmed no irritation.
Gentle exfoliation
- Use a glycolic acid (5–10%) or salicylic acid (1–2%) product no more than twice per week.
- Apply after washing, before deodorant. Never apply acid immediately after shaving.

Apple cider vinegar rinse
- Dilute to one part ACV in three parts water minimum.
- Apply with a cotton pad, leave 30 seconds, rinse well.
- Skip entirely on freshly shaved skin or any broken skin. Undiluted ACV can alter skin pH and cause burns on thin axillary skin.
Topical probiotics and prebiotics
Early research suggests topical probiotic formulations may help rebalance underarm bacteria, but robust clinical evidence is still developing. If you choose to try one, treat it as a complement to the hygiene baseline, not a replacement.
Patch-test instructions
Apply any new ingredient to your inner forearm. Wait 48 hours. If you see redness, swelling, or itching, do not use that ingredient on your underarms.
For sensitive skin: choose a natural deodorant with magnesium hydroxide or zinc ricinoleate as the active ingredient rather than sodium bicarbonate (baking soda). Magnesium hydroxide neutralises odour without the high pH that makes baking soda irritating for many people. Zinc ricinoleate physically binds odour molecules without shifting skin pH at all.

Risks, red flags, and when to see a clinician
Most irritation from a natural deodorant detox is mild and resolves within 48 hours of stopping the offending product. Some reactions require medical attention.
Stop immediately and see a clinician if you notice:
- 🔴 Severe burning or stinging that doesn’t ease after rinsing
- 🔴 Blistering or skin peeling
- 🔴 A spreading rash beyond the underarm area
- 🔴 Swelling, warmth, or pus (signs of possible infection)
- 🔴 Fever or systemic symptoms alongside skin changes
If mild irritation (redness, minor itching) doesn’t resolve within 48–72 hours of stopping the product and washing the area gently, book an appointment with your family doctor or a board-certified dermatologist.
For persistent sweating or severe odour that doesn’t improve after six weeks, clinical options exist: prescription-strength antiperspirants (aluminium chloride hexahydrate), topical glycopyrronium, botulinum toxin (Botox) injections for hyperhidrosis, or a medical evaluation to rule out underlying conditions like bromhidrosis or skin infection. A dermatologist can also perform formal patch testing to identify specific ingredient allergies if reactions keep recurring.
How to pick a natural deodorant in Canada
The ingredient list tells you almost everything you need to know. Here is what to look for based on your skin and sweat profile:
- ✅ Magnesium hydroxide — gentle pH-neutralising action; best for sensitive skin or baking-soda reactors
- ✅ Zinc ricinoleate — odour-binding without pH shift; good for tolerant skin and moderate sweaters
- ✅ Kaolin or activated charcoal — absorbs moisture and residue; useful for heavier sweaters
- ✅ Low or no fragrance — synthetic fragrance is a common irritant during the transition phase
- ❌ Sodium bicarbonate (baking soda) — effective but high pH causes rash in a significant portion of users; avoid if you have sensitive skin or a history of reactions
- ❌ Undisclosed “fragrance” blends — can mask dozens of potential allergens
For light sweaters with sensitive skin, a magnesium hydroxide cream formula in a low-fragrance base is the safest starting point. For heavier sweaters with tolerant skin, a zinc ricinoleate or charcoal-based stick tends to perform better through a full workday.
Check the label for: the active ingredient (listed first or second), fragrance level (ideally “unscented” or essential-oil only), base format (cream vs. stick — creams are gentler on irritated skin), and country of production.

Your 7-step protocol and 7-day checklist
7-step quick protocol
- Stop antiperspirant completely — partial use prolongs the adjustment.
- Switch to a magnesium hydroxide or zinc ricinoleate natural deodorant on Day 1.
- Wash underarms with a gentle cleanser morning and evening for the first two weeks.
- Pat skin fully dry before every deodorant application.
- On Day 7, do your first clay mask (10–15 minutes, rinse well, once weekly).
- If odour peaks around Days 7–10, add a midday rinse and reapplication.
- Track your skin’s response daily — if irritation appears, simplify back to washing only.

Myths versus evidence: a quick science check
Myth: Clay masks remove systemic toxins from your body.
Evidence: No clinical support exists for this claim. The liver and kidneys are your body’s detox organs. Sweat contains trace amounts of some compounds, but it is not a primary elimination pathway. Medical consensus is clear on this point.
Myth: The smell means your body is releasing toxins.
Evidence: The smell is microbially driven. Peer-reviewed research shows antiperspirant use measurably shifts underarm bacterial communities, and stopping antiperspirant allows odour-producing species to temporarily dominate. It’s a bacterial bloom, not a purge.
Myth: You need an aggressive detox protocol to reset.
Evidence: Simple washing removes most antiperspirant residue. Clay masks and gentle acids can provide symptomatic relief and are worth trying, but they are optional additions, not requirements.
What the evidence does support:
- Local residue removal via washing or clay masks ✅
- pH shifts from diluted acids that discourage odour bacteria ✅
- Microbiome rebalancing over 2–6 weeks with consistent hygiene ✅
- Ingredient choice (magnesium hydroxide, zinc ricinoleate) reducing irritation risk ✅
- Topical probiotics as a promising but still early-stage approach ⚠️
The practical conclusion: time, gentle hygiene, and the right ingredient choice are the real drivers of a successful transition. Aggressive detox recipes add risk without adding meaningful benefit.
The transition is worth it, but skip the dramatic protocols
Most articles about the natural deodorant detox either oversell the “toxin purge” narrative or dismiss the whole thing as pseudoscience. Neither is quite right.
The transition is genuinely uncomfortable for some people, particularly during that Days 4–14 window. Dismissing that discomfort doesn’t help anyone. At the same time, the idea that you need a weeks-long intensive protocol involving daily clay masks, baking soda scrubs, and undiluted vinegar is not only unsupported, it’s how people end up with chemical burns on their underarms.
What actually works is simpler: stop the aluminium product, wash well, choose a natural deodorant with a skin-compatible active ingredient, and give your microbiome time to rebalance. A weekly clay mask is a reasonable optional addition. Gentle acids, used sparingly, can help. Everything else is largely noise.
The one thing most guides underemphasise is ingredient selection. Baking soda is in a huge number of natural deodorants because it works, but it works by raising skin pH dramatically, and a meaningful portion of people react to it with a rash that gets blamed on “detox” when it’s actually a pH burn. Choosing magnesium hydroxide or zinc ricinoleate from the start avoids that entirely. That single swap prevents more failed transitions than any mask protocol.
